Dubai
MasterMind PR
Advertising Agencies
canada satellite tr, 2 Sharjah United Arab Emirates
Al Baraem Electronics LLC, Ajman Academy Road Mowaihat 2 Ajman United Arab Emirates
Crystal Petroleum, Hamriya Free Zone Sharjah United Arab Emirates
Dream Bridge Technical Contracting Sharjah UAE, Office 102 Salem Obaid Al Suwaidi Building Maleha St Sharjah United Arab Emirates
MasterMind PR, Block 18 King Salman Bin Abdulaziz Al Saud St Al Sufouh Al Sufouh 2
+971506539443